Role specifics and benefits are designed to support your clinical excellence and your overall wellbeing. Key responsibilities include comprehensive ICU nursing care for critically ill adults, continuous monitoring of hemodynamics, ventilator management, sedation and analgesia oversight, rapid response and code team participation, and meticulous documentation to ensure continuity of care. You’ll assess and implement evidence-based care plans, collaborate with respiratory therapists, pharmacists, and the broader ICU team, and advocate for patient safety and family engagement. The opportunity for professional growth is substantial: you can deepen expertise in neurocritical care, shock states, sepsis management, and advanced life support competencies, while benefiting from structured orientation and ongoing clinical mentorship.
